    Another vote for Shimano SS inners, which are more flexible and shiny than standard shop cables from the big box. I actually polish mine then wax them lightly with Mr Sheen rubbed along them before I fit because the fully-hidden rear gear cable on my roadie is awkwardly routed and shifts poorly. I also waterproof the outer cable ends at the rear derailleur with lanolin or petroleum jelly to keep out the damp, which rusts the ends and cruds everything up causing poor shifting. This treatment seems to have improved matters, for the summer at least.

    glasgowdan
    Free Member

    Best thing about sp41 and 1.1mm is each end will cost about £5, no need for anything else and it really does last a long time. I’ve tried various cable kits in the past and nothing comes close to this beautifully simplistic combination. No need for cable oilers as no crud or water gets in there in the first place.
